This World Environment Day, electric mobility platform Bijliride has launched its new digital campaign film, “#ChotiRideBadaKal”, driving home the message that sustainable choices do not need to be dramatic. The campaign is anchored in the central philosophy: “Aapka Safar, Desh Ka Sudhar” (Your Journey, The Nation’s Progress). Through its affordable EV rental model, Bijliride aims to show that you do not have to be an environmental activist to make a difference—sometimes, simply choosing a cleaner way to handle your daily travel is enough to protect the planet, one trip at a time.
The campaign film shifts the focus away from grand corporate promises to highlight the ordinary, relatable journey of a young delivery rider using a rented Bijliride electric scooter. Like millions of working Indians, his immediate focus is entirely on managing his daily commute and earning a livelihood, rather than changing the world. As his day unfolds through a series of realistic, slice-of-life moments—including deliveries, quick chai breaks, and routine errands—every kilometer he rides quietly cuts down carbon emissions and fossil fuel consumption without him even realizing it.
The emotional turning point arrives at the end of the day when a child in his family points out the cumulative positive impact of his travel. What felt like a routine, ordinary commute suddenly becomes a deeply meaningful contribution toward a greener future. Built with minimal dialogue and natural city ambiance, the film avoids preachy environmental lectures, focusing instead on raw human connection and the quiet power of everyday choices.
